AI Technical Summary

Technical Problem

The existing cable brackets have fixed spacing or require manual adjustment, which makes them unsuitable, cumbersome to operate, and poses safety hazards.

Method used

Design an adjustable-spacing cable bracket that uses the cable's own weight to drive the movement of the first and second fasteners. Automatic adjustment and fixing are achieved through driving and transmission components, and precise adjustment and automatic reset are achieved by combining fixed slide rails and elastic components.

Benefits of technology

It enables automatic adjustment and fixing of cable bracket spacing without manual operation, reducing labor intensity, improving work efficiency, enhancing versatility and practicality, and avoiding safety hazards.

Abstract

本实用新型涉及一种可调节间距的电缆支架,包括基座、第一紧固件、传动件和第二紧固件,所述基座内置驱动件,所述驱动件包括第一驱动端以及第二驱动端,所述第一驱动端与所述第二驱动端传动连接,且所述第一驱动端的预设运动方向与所述第二驱动端的预设运动方向相反。本实用新型利用电缆的自重来驱动第一紧固件和第二紧固件移动,实现了电缆支架间距的自动调节和自动固定电缆,无需人工手动操作,降低操作人员劳动强度,避免了狭小空间作业的安全隐患,大幅提高了工作效率。

Claims

1. An adjustable spacing cable support, characterized by, include: The base has a built-in driving component, which includes a first driving end and a second driving end. The first driving end and the second driving end are connected in a transmission manner, and the preset movement direction of the first driving end is opposite to the preset movement direction of the second driving end. A first fastener, one end of which is connected to the first driving end of the driving component, and the other end of which is used to support the cable. A transmission component, comprising: a first push rod and a push plate, wherein the first push rod is placed on one side of the first fastener, one end of the first push rod is connected to the second drive end, the other end of the first push rod is connected to the push plate, and the push plate is inclined away from the first fastener; The second fastener includes a second push rod and a fastening body. One end of the second push rod abuts against the side of the push plate facing the first fastener, and the other end of the second push rod is connected to the fastening body. The fastening body is used to fix the cable. A fixed slide rail is sleeved on the second push rod, and the fixed slide rail is used to fix and guide the push rod to move in a direction close to or away from the first fastener.

2. An adjustable spacing cable support according to claim 1, wherein, Also includes: A counterweight is fixedly disposed below the base and is used to lower the center of gravity of the cable support.

3. An adjustable spacing cable support according to claim 1, wherein, The fixed slide rail is adapted to the second push rod, and the fixed slide rail is a straight rail or an arc-shaped rail.

4. The adjustable spacing cable support of claim 1, wherein, The driving component is a hydraulic rod; the hydraulic rod includes: a cylinder, a first cylinder liner, and two second cylinder liners; the first cylinder liner and the second cylinder liners are in communication with the cylinder, and the first cylinder liner is positioned between the two second cylinder liners; The first push rod is adapted to the second cylinder liner, and the end of the first fastener near the base is adapted to the first cylinder liner; the first cylinder liner is the first driving end, and the second cylinder liner is the second driving end.

5. An adjustable spacing cable support according to claim 4, wherein, Also includes: First elastic element; One end of the first elastic element is connected to the second push rod, and the other end is connected to the transmission element to drive the second fastener to reset.

6. An adjustable spacing cable support as defined in claim 1, wherein, The driving component includes a connecting rod and a second elastic element. One end of the connecting rod is rotatably connected to the first fastener, and the other end of the connecting rod is rotatably connected to the first push rod. The connecting rod is rotatably connected to the base. The second elastic element is placed below the first fastener, and both ends of the second elastic element abut against the first fastener and the base, respectively.

7. An adjustable spacing cable support as defined in claim 1 wherein, The push plate has an array of protrusions on the side surface near the first fastener.

8. An adjustable spacing cable support as defined in claim 1, wherein, Also includes: The housing is mounted on the transmission component, and the fixed slide rail is fixedly mounted on the side wall of the housing.

9. The adjustable-spacing cable bracket according to claim 1, characterized in that, The second drive end, the second fastener, and the transmission component are symmetrically arranged on both sides of the first fastener.
